For good measure, they added another South Jersey shortstop, but this time in the 16th round. With the 491st overall pick, the Phillies drafted Logan Dawson from Eastern. Dawson, a Boston College commit, scored 36 runs this past season with the Vikings, adding 15 extra-base hits 14 stolen bases.
